Community/species contributed by larval slicks (assumed broader than aquaculture)

Larval enrichment will be simulated as the addition of 1-yr old coral recruits on a set of reefs (ReefMod/CoCoNet) or reef sites (IPMF/CoCoNet). This means that we won’t simulate settlement from a pool of larvae but rather assume that the intervention resulted in the successful establishment of coral recruits that grew and survived over one year post settlement.
